Assemblage

At this time, usually in March, rather than rack the different lots of new wine from barrel to barrel, the wines are brought to tanks where a blend is made.  The wine is thoroughly mixed and then brought from the tank back to barrel.  Sometimes the winemaker is unsure of how a wine or a group of wines will age, and he may question how they might fit into the blend.  In such a case, he may make a second blend fraction which is held separately during aging for observation.  He may at a later date reconsider the final bottling blend for inclusion of this separate lot.
